However, it lacks the ports information, which is often valuable for troubleshooting. This patch adds both source and destination port numbers, 'sport' and 'dport' respectively, to TCP, UDP, UDP-Lite and SCTP-related NETFILTER_PKT records. $ TESTS="netfilter_pkt" make -e test &> /dev/null $ ausearch -i -ts recent |grep NETFILTER_PKT type=NETFILTER_PKT ... proto=icmp type=NETFILTER_PKT ... proto=ipv6-icmp type=NETFILTER_PKT ... proto=udp sport=46333 dport=42424 type=NETFILTER_PKT ... proto=udp sport=35953 dport=42424 type=NETFILTER_PKT ... proto=tcp sport=50314 dport=42424 type=NETFILTER_PKT ... proto=tcp sport=57346 dport=42424 Link: https://github.com/linux-audit/audit-kernel/issues/162 Signed-off-by: Ricardo Robaina --- kernel/audit.c | 89 +++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++--- 1 file changed, 85 insertions(+), 4 deletions(-) diff --git a/kernel/audit.c b/kernel/audit.c index 09764003db74..bc7217402a35 100644 --- a/kernel/audit.c +++ b/kernel/audit.c @@ -60,6 +60,7 @@ #include #include #include +#include #include "audit.h" @@ -2549,8 +2550,48 @@ bool audit_log_packet_ip4(struct audit_buffer *ab, struct sk_buff *skb) if (!ih) return false; - audit_log_format(ab, " saddr=%pI4 daddr=%pI4 proto=%hhu", - &ih->saddr, &ih->daddr, ih->protocol); + switch (ih->protocol) { + case IPPROTO_TCP: + struct tcphdr _tcph; + const struct tcphdr *th; + + th = skb_header_pointer(skb, skb_transport_offset(skb), sizeof(_tcph), &_tcph); + if (!th) + return false; + + audit_log_format(ab, " saddr=%pI4 daddr=%pI4 proto=%hhu sport=%hu dport=%hu", + &ih->saddr, &ih->daddr, ih->protocol, + ntohs(th->source), ntohs(th->dest)); + break; + case IPPROTO_UDP: + case IPPROTO_UDPLITE: + struct udphdr _udph; + const struct udphdr *uh; + + uh = skb_header_pointer(skb, skb_transport_offset(skb), sizeof(_udph), &_udph); + if (!uh) + return false; + + audit_log_format(ab, " saddr=%pI4 daddr=%pI4 proto=%hhu sport=%hu dport=%hu", + &ih->saddr, &ih->daddr, ih->protocol, + ntohs(uh->source), ntohs(uh->dest)); + break; + case IPPROTO_SCTP: + struct sctphdr _sctph; + const struct sctphdr *sh; + + sh = skb_header_pointer(skb, skb_transport_offset(skb), sizeof(_sctph), &_sctph); + if (!sh) + return false; + + audit_log_format(ab, " saddr=%pI4 daddr=%pI4 proto=%hhu sport=%hu dport=%hu", + &ih->saddr, &ih->daddr, ih->protocol, + ntohs(sh->source), ntohs(sh->dest)); + break; + default: + audit_log_format(ab, " saddr=%pI4 daddr=%pI4 proto=%hhu", + &ih->saddr, &ih->daddr, ih->protocol); + } return true; } @@ -2570,8 +2611,48 @@ bool audit_log_packet_ip6(struct audit_buffer *ab, struct sk_buff *skb) nexthdr = ih->nexthdr; ipv6_skip_exthdr(skb, skb_network_offset(skb) + sizeof(_ip6h), &nexthdr, &frag_off); - audit_log_format(ab, " saddr=%pI6c daddr=%pI6c proto=%hhu", - &ih->saddr, &ih->daddr, nexthdr); + switch (nexthdr) { + case IPPROTO_TCP: + struct tcphdr _tcph; + const struct tcphdr *th; + + th = skb_header_pointer(skb, skb_transport_offset(skb), sizeof(_tcph), &_tcph); + if (!th) + return false; + + audit_log_format(ab, " saddr=%pI6c daddr=%pI6c proto=%hhu sport=%hu dport=%hu", + &ih->saddr, &ih->daddr, nexthdr, + ntohs(th->source), ntohs(th->dest)); + break; + case IPPROTO_UDP: + case IPPROTO_UDPLITE: + struct udphdr _udph; + const struct udphdr *uh; + + uh = skb_header_pointer(skb, skb_transport_offset(skb), sizeof(_udph), &_udph); + if (!uh) + return false; + + audit_log_format(ab, " saddr=%pI6c daddr=%pI6c proto=%hhu sport=%hu dport=%hu", + &ih->saddr, &ih->daddr, nexthdr, + ntohs(uh->source), ntohs(uh->dest)); + break; + case IPPROTO_SCTP: + struct sctphdr _sctph; + const struct sctphdr *sh; + + sh = skb_header_pointer(skb, skb_transport_offset(skb), sizeof(_sctph), &_sctph); + if (!sh) + return false; + + audit_log_format(ab, " saddr=%pI6c daddr=%pI6c proto=%hhu sport=%hu dport=%hu", + &ih->saddr, &ih->daddr, nexthdr, + ntohs(sh->source), ntohs(sh->dest)); + break; + default: + audit_log_format(ab, " saddr=%pI6c daddr=%pI6c proto=%hhu", + &ih->saddr, &ih->daddr, nexthdr); + } return true; } -- 2.51.0
